How to Buy Your First Bitcoin, Step by Step

Six steps, no guesswork.

6 min read ยท Free

Buying bitcoin for the first time takes about fifteen minutes. Here's the whole process laid out so nothing surprises you.

Step 1 โ€” Pick a reputable exchange

An exchange is a service that swaps your local currency for bitcoin. Choose one that's well established in your country, publishes clear fees, and lets you withdraw to your own wallet.

Avoid platforms that won't let you withdraw. A place you can't leave isn't a wallet, it's a trap.

Step 2 โ€” Verify your identity

Most regulated exchanges require ID verification. It usually means a photo of your ID and a selfie, and it takes a few minutes.

Use a strong, unique password and turn on two-factor authentication with an authenticator app rather than SMS.

Step 3 โ€” Start small and buy

You do not need to buy a whole bitcoin. It divides into 100 million units called satoshis, so a $20 purchase is perfectly normal.

Many people set up a recurring weekly or monthly buy โ€” dollar-cost averaging โ€” so they stop worrying about timing the market.

Step 4 โ€” Withdraw to your own wallet

Once you own more than pocket change, move it off the exchange to a wallet you control. Send a small test amount first, confirm it arrives, then send the rest.

Double-check the receiving address, and remember that Bitcoin transactions cannot be reversed.

Step 5 โ€” Back up your recovery phrase

Your wallet will show you 12 or 24 words. Those words are your money. Write them on paper (or stamp them into metal), store them somewhere safe and private, and never type them into a website or photograph them.

Key takeaways

  • You can start with $20 โ€” bitcoin is highly divisible.
  • Always send a small test transaction first.
  • Your recovery phrase is your money. Guard it offline.
